About Media, Technology and Telecoms Law in Tangier, Morocco

Media, Technology, and Telecoms Law in Tangier, Morocco are a complex and continuously evolving legal field that governs the use, regulation, and protection of media, technology, and telecommunications industries in the city. This area of law covers a broad range of issues such as intellectual property rights, privacy concerns, data protection, licensing agreements, and competition law.

Local Laws Overview

In Tangier, Morocco, the legal framework governing Media, Technology, and Telecoms is primarily based on the country's constitution, relevant legislation, and regulations. Some key aspects of local laws that are particularly relevant to this field include the Telecommunications Law, the E-Commerce Law, the Copyright Law, the Data Protection Law, and the Competition Law.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key regulations governing the telecom sector in Tangier, Morocco?

The key regulations governing the telecom sector in Tangier, Morocco are the Telecommunications Law and the specific regulations issued by the National Telecommunications Regulatory Agency (ANRT).

How can I protect my intellectual property in Tangier, Morocco?

You can protect your intellectual property in Tangier, Morocco by registering your trademarks, patents, and copyrights with the relevant authorities such as the Moroccan Industrial Property Office (OMPIC).

What are the data protection requirements for businesses in Tangier, Morocco?

Businesses in Tangier, Morocco are required to comply with the Data Protection Law, which sets out rules for the collection, processing, and storage of personal data.

What are the penalties for non-compliance with media regulations in Tangier, Morocco?

Non-compliance with media regulations in Tangier, Morocco can result in fines, suspension of licenses, or other administrative sanctions imposed by the relevant regulatory authorities.

Can I challenge a decision made by the National Telecommunications Regulatory Agency (ANRT) in Tangier, Morocco?

Yes, you can challenge a decision made by the ANRT in Tangier, Morocco by filing an appeal with the relevant administrative court.

What are the competition law considerations for telecom companies in Tangier, Morocco?

Telecom companies in Tangier, Morocco must comply with competition law requirements, including restrictions on anti-competitive practices such as price-fixing, market allocation, and abuse of dominant position.

How does the E-Commerce Law impact online businesses in Tangier, Morocco?

The E-Commerce Law in Tangier, Morocco sets out rules for online transactions, electronic contracts, consumer protection, and liability of service providers, which impact online businesses operating in the city.

What are the rights of consumers in relation to telecom services in Tangier, Morocco?

Consumers in Tangier, Morocco have rights protected by the Telecom Law, including the right to choose their service provider, receive clear information on services and prices, and have their privacy and data protected.

Additional Resources

For additional resources related to Media, Technology, and Telecoms Law in Tangier, Morocco, you may consult the National Telecommunications Regulatory Agency (ANRT), the Moroccan Industrial Property Office (OMPIC), the Ministry of Culture and Communication, and the Ministry of Industry, Investment, Trade, and Digital Economy.
